Нервная система Биткойна получает обновление с помощью сети FIBER | RU.democraziakmzero.org

Нервная система Биткойна получает обновление с помощью сети FIBER

Нервная система Биткойна получает обновление с помощью сети FIBER

Продолжительное усилие для перемещения данных для операционные блоков Bitcoin по всему миру более эффективно получило обновление.

Поскольку Bitcoin был освобожден, массив услуг или решений возникли для удовлетворения потребностей тех, кто использует цифровую валюту. К ним относятся обмены, которые позволяют Bitcoin быть куплена и продана для государственных эмиссионных валют; miningpools, выросший, как шахтеры стремились коллективизировать для большей прибыли; и новые виды кошельков, которые доставленных лучшую функциональность и безопасность.

Но, некоторые потребности распределенной сети не очевидны для наблюдателей.

Как Bitcoin основного разработчик Грег Максвелл ставит его, Bitcoin Relay Network, детище сотрудника Bitcoin Основного вкладчик Мэттом Corallo, возникло несколько лет назад в ответ на необходимость для распространения данных Bitcoin блока более быстро среди шахтеров, или тех, кто обрабатывает свои операции.

«Пара лет назад, как блоки начали получать выше 250k регулярно мы увидели, что выглядело как быстрая консолидация шахтеров к наиболее популярным бассейнам. Одной из причин были меньше, бассейны испытывают высокое осиротение,» вспоминает Максвелл.

Он сказал CoinDesk:

«Казалось, что мы быстро были на тенденции, где только будет существовать единый пул.»

Тем не менее, он сказал Corallo возникла в действие, разработка оригинального реле сети и доставки, что Максвелл назвал «радикально улучшен блок скорости распространения».

Relay сеть Bitcoin в конечном счете, материализовалась в виде сети узлов, расположенных в Китае, Европе, Северной Америке, России и Юго-Восточной Азии. Каждый из узлов спортивного надежного соединения с Интернетом, и в теории действует как железная дорога для блока данных. Данные сжимается и затем передается через протокол управления передачей или TCP.

Эта система была описана как сосудистой или нервной системы Bitcoin в - важный компонент для доставки информации по всему телу. Теперь, усовершенствованный преемник был освобожден.

Введите ВОЛОКНО

Corallo недавно представила Fast Internet Relay Bitcoin Engine (клетчатка), усилия, направленные на создание более мощной версии к ретрансляционной сети Bitcoin.

Идея заключается в том, что за счет повышения скорости, при которой транспортируемый эта информация, шахтеры могут уменьшить количество бесхозных блоков или блоков транзакций, которые отклоняются от сети в пользу другого создал вокруг этого времени.

Corallo, который оперировал оригинальную сеть и разработал новую версию, говорит, что эта инициатива также способствовала увеличению стоимости эгоистичен miningand сократить количество пустых блоков, полученных путем добычи SPV.

Но, по словам Corallo, существующая сеть реле стала «показывать свой возраст» в прошлом году, побуждая работу над новым программным обеспечением в течение последних нескольких месяцев.

Он сказал CoinDesk:

«За последние несколько лет работы его и очень тщательно бенчмаркинг его, я обнаружил, что вы просто не можете получить вид надежного реле с малой задержкой, которую при использовании TCP в любой форме. Несколько месяцев назад я, наконец, получил вокруг, начиная с нуля, чтобы построить новый протокол быстро реле, строительство Компактные блоки в качестве фундамента и ранних версий ВОЛОКНА одновременно «.

На вопросе, Коралло объяснено, было то, что сеть, которая функционирует с помощью TCP была чувствительна к потере данных, что потребует дополнительной обработки (и, таким образом увеличивая время, необходимое для передачи блоков). Он объяснил в своем блоге представляя ВОЛОКНА, что с TCP пакеты данных могут быть потеряны по пути.

«Только тогда отправитель ретранслировать потерянные пакеты, что позволяет приемнику на (потенциально) восстановить первоначальную передачу,» написал он.

Эти дополнительные раз туда-обратно, в конечном счете вызвал спайку в реле времени на оригинальной ретрансляционной сети, пояснил он.

Обновление фибры

Чтобы обойти эту проблему задержки - время, в котором он принимает пакеты данных из одной точки в другую (в данном случае, от узла к узлу), Corallo сказал он обратился к другому протоколу, в User Datagram Protocol (UDP).

«Вместо того, чтобы использовать TCP для передачи данных, необходимых для передачи блока один раз и опираясь на полном спуско-обнаруживать и RESEND потерянных пакетов, FIBER отправляет данные, используя UDP с данными дополнительной упреждающей коррекции ошибок (FEC) (то есть данные, которые позволяют вам реконструировать полную передаваемую информацию, даже если некоторые Пропала),»сказал он CoinDesk.

Это этот последний элемент, ПИО, что Максвелл упоминается как «немного технологии магия».

Макияж волокна также включает в себя BIP 152, предложение для «компактных блоков», направленных на сокращение количества полосы пропускания, используемое при движении блока данных от узла к узлу.

«Таким образом, даже если некоторые части теряются, блок еще получил очень быстро и без взад и вперед связи,» объяснил Максвелл. «Он также сохраняет свою скорость, даже если блок не очень похож на приемники mempool.»

Сетевые эффекты

Тем не менее, для всех усовершенствований, наиболее амбициозная цель Fiber является, возможно, попытка заставить людей по всему миру, чтобы запустить несколько сетей.

Первоначально сеть поддерживалась под эгидой самого Corallo, а это означает, что его работа - как и с любым Bitcoin узла - зависела его способности поддерживать его.

Несмотря на свой код быть свободно доступен, Corallo сказал, что не было большим аппетит, чтобы встать дополнительные сети. В конечном счете, успех сети (или систему сетей), возможно, зависит от получения большего количества людей на самом деле запустить их.

FIBER стремится изменить эту динамику. Программное обеспечение предназначено для работы в качестве дополнения к Bitcoin Ядру, предлагая путь для больше людей, чтобы вступить в контакт с кодом и потенциально запустить свою собственную релейную сеть.

По Corallo, ведется работа, чтобы поощрить другую партию создавать свои собственные волоконные релейные сети - усилие по его словам, необходимо, чтобы держать вещи децентрализованных.

Corallo также опубликовал guidefor установку до оптоволоконных сетей.

В то же время, он сказал, что новые группы сейчас заинтересованы в создании систем ретрансляции, и он, в настоящее время, осторожный оптимизм больше пользователей будет способствовать делу.

Он продолжил:

«Я не уверен, если я должен упомянуть их по имени, но я уверен, по крайней мере, два или так будет стоять что-то и сделать его общедоступным soonish.»

Bitcoin CoreRelay сети

Похожие новости


Post Bitcoin

Поставщик платежей Bitrefill запускает успешный тест транзакции молнии

Post Bitcoin

Bitcoin Foundation выбирает BitGo Enterprise для служб финансового управления

Post Bitcoin

Готовитесь к удалению? Цена биткойнов падает ниже $ 6,000

Post Bitcoin

BitAngels закрывает 10 000 фондов BTC для децентрализованных приложений

Post Bitcoin

100 голландских торговцев получат биткойнские терминалы в Giveaway

Post Bitcoin

Биткойн в 2017 году: хеджирование девальвации валюты для развивающихся рынков

Post Bitcoin

12 мест, чтобы потратить свой биткойн в эту черную пятницу

Post Bitcoin

Цена биткойна на Shaky Ground после 1,000% прибыли

Post Bitcoin

Биткойн Австралия запускает превентивный удар по ограничительным налогам

Post Bitcoin

Цена биткойна превышает $ 300, капли после греческого спасения

Post Bitcoin

BTC China запускает первый интерфейс ATM Bitcoin

Post Bitcoin

Только молния? Масштабирование биткойна может потребовать целого другого слоя